Ag. Anshits et al., THE PECULIARITIES OF N2O ACTIVATION OVER OXIDES OF ALKALI-EARTH METALS IN THE OXIDATIVE COUPLING OF METHANE, Catalysis today, 21(2-3), 1994, pp. 281-287
The catalytic properties of Na/CaO with a low amount of alkali promote
r and SrO were studied under comparable conditions, using CH4-O-2 and
CH4-N2O reaction mixtures. CH4 conversion was similar for both oxidant
s (<5%). Nitrous oxide was shown to be more active and selective oxida
nt than oxygen. It was noted that molecular oxygen influenced the rate
of N2O decomposition over SrO, while for Na/CaO catalysts such effect
was not observed. Two different schemes for N2O decomposition over ca
talysts studied were found. Carbon dioxide decreases the production of
ethane SrO when N2O is used as an oxidant.
